Muharram Shaaban Hussein Al-Barghouthi was born in the town of Kobar in the Ramallah and Al-Bireh Governorate in 1954. He studied the primary stage at Kobar Elementary School, and the secondary stage at Prince Hassan Secondary School in the town of Birzeit. He worked as a correspondent and agent for Al-Fajr newspaper in 1975, then for Al-Tali’ah newspaper in 1977, and was Director General in the Ministry of Youth and Sports between (1997-2004).

In his early youth, he experienced returning to Palestine by smuggling himself from Jordan after the 1967 war, and witnessed the effects of the war on his way back to his village. He became involved in national activism during his secondary school studies with the secret student union affiliated with the Communist Party in 1972, and became an active member of the Communist Party.

He participated in establishing student councils in schools in the Ramallah, Al-Bireh, and Jerusalem areas, including Prince Hassan, Al-Hashimiyah, Al-Ma'mouniyah, and Al-Bireh Girls' Secondary School. He contributed to urging people not to work in the Israeli market in the first half of the 1970s. He began a long career in volunteer work starting in 1973, volunteering with farmers in the town of Kobar and then moving to other villages. Among those who participated with him in volunteer work during that period were Azmi Al-Shuaibi, Suhair Al-Barghouthi, Salim Tamari, Hanan Ashrawi, and others. He also focused on spreading the idea of volunteer work in the Palestinian press.

 He participated in a large meeting at Birzeit University on August 15, 1980, which included representatives from thirty-six volunteer committees in the West Bank and Gaza Strip. At this meeting, the establishment of volunteer work committees in the West Bank and Gaza was announced, and he was elected its president. The new union body established its headquarters in Jerusalem and the cities of Ramallah and Al-Bireh, and began organizing volunteer work in Palestine. Its activities commenced with a volunteer event in Nazareth on August 20, with the participation of 1,500 volunteers from all parts of Palestine. The experience was then repeated in Nazareth in 1982 with the participation of thousands of volunteers.

 The volunteer work committees adopted the slogan "The land is identity," providing assistance to farmers in the West Bank and Gaza, commemorating national occasions, particularly Land Day, and contributing to the rejection of Zionist projects aimed at undermining Palestinian national aspirations, such as the Village Leagues project. They also affirmed that the Palestine Liberation Organization (PLO) was the representative of the Palestinian people. Despite their continued work, the occupation authorities banned the volunteer work committees. With the outbreak of the Intifada, these committees transformed into popular committees that played a leading role in the national and social movement within the neighborhoods of Palestinian refugee camps, cities, and towns.

Barghouti worked to establish the Palestinian Youth Union and became its director in 1992. He worked on its independence from organizational frameworks since 1996. Barghouti also progressed in organizational responsibilities within the People’s Party until he became a member of its Central Committee, and remained in it until he resigned from the party in 1996. He ran in the legislative elections in 1996, and for the past two years he has been working with a group of young people in building the National Social Youth Movement, which has been joined by about 1,000 young men and women.

Barghouti suffered in his life, as he was placed under house arrest for a year in the city of Al-Bireh between (1987-1988), and the occupation forces stormed his house and searched it more than once, and he was summoned by the occupation intelligence, and arrested in 1988.
